Endocannabinoid System (ECS)

The endocannabinoid system (also called ECS) is a network of receptors, molecules (endocannabinoids), and enzymes found inside the human body. This system is found throughout the human body, including the brain, spinal cord, gut, and immune system. The role it plays depends on many factors, but it is ultimately a regulatory system. Care Quality Commission (CQC)

The Care Quality Commission (CQC) is the independent regulator of health and social care services in England. The CQC ensures that clinics, hospitals, and other healthcare providers deliver safe, effective, compassionate, and high-quality care to patients. Cannabidiol (CBD)

CBD (cannabidiol) is a natural compound found in the cannabis plant. It’s available in over-the-counter wellness products and prescription medicines, each with different regulations and uses.
